I bought a skoda fabia on finance when they were offering 0% interest and a dealer contribution of £1000. I chopped in a car valued at £500 and it costs me £166 a month. I love it.

I agree with you OP! Recently had a broken car and repair would cost more than value of car. Looked around for finance or new/nearly new and realised that there is nothing much under £10k and that is for a small engine so harder driving on motorway. Ended up paying over £1k on repair as I weighed up the car has another 5 yrs in it and ultimately it was still the cheapest option. In other European countries cars hold their value much more but in UK seems that after 5-7 years ours are only worth scrap :-(.
